HOW TO APPLY
Candidates have to apply online from 21.09.2024 to 04.10.2024 through the link
provided in the Bank’s website www.canarabank.com  Careers Recruitment
Engagement of Graduate Apprentice in Canara Bank under Apprenticeship Act, 1961
for FY 2024-25. and no other mode of application will be accepted. Candidate will have
to mention their enrollment ID generated after applying on NATS portal while applying
for training seats.

Pre-Requisites for Applying Online:


Before applying online, candidates should—
a) scan:
- photograph (4.5cm × 3.5cm)
- signature
- left thumb impression (If a candidate is not having left thumb, he/she may use
his/ her right thumb. If both thumbs are missing, the impression of one of the
fingers of the left hand starting from the forefinger should be taken. If there are
no fingers on the left hand, the impression of one of the fingers of the right hand
starting from the forefinger should be taken. If no fingers are available, the
impression of left toe may be taken. In all such cases where left thumb
impression is not uploaded, the candidate should specify in the uploaded
document the name of finger and the specification of left/right hand or toe).
- Hand written declaration (text given below) {In case of candidates who cannot
write may get the text of declaration typed and put their left hand thumb
impression (if not able to sign also) below the typed declaration and upload the
document as per specifications}. ensuring that all these scanned documents
adhere to the required specifications as given in this Notification.
a) Signature in CAPITAL LETTERS will NOT be accepted.
b) The photograph/ signature/ left thumb impression/ handwritten declaration/
should be properly scanned and should not be smudged/ blurred.
c) The text for the hand written declaration is as follows –
“I, _______ (Name of the candidate), hereby declare that all the information
submitted by me in the application form is correct, true and valid. I will present
the supporting documents as and when required.”
d) The above mentioned hand written declaration has to be in the candidate’s hand
writing and in English only and should NOT BE IN CAPITAL LETTERS. If it is written
by anybody else or in any other language, the application will be considered as
invalid.
e) Keep the necessary details/documents ready to make Online Payment of the
requisite application fee/ intimation charges
f) Have a valid personal email ID/Mobile number, which should be kept active till
the completion of the process. IBPS/Bank may send intimation regarding call
letters through the registered e-mail ID/Mobile number. In case a candidate does
not have a valid personal e-mail ID, he/she should create his/her new email ID
before applying on-line and must maintain that email account.

Procedure for applying online:


Candidates should visit the Bank’s website www.canarabank.com and click on the
careers page and then click on Recruitment and then click on link Engagement of
Graduate Apprentice in Canara Bank under Apprenticeship Act, 1961 for FY 2024-25.
 Candidates will have to click on “CLICK HERE FOR NEW REGISTRATION” to register
their application by entering their basic information in the online application form.
After that a provisional registration number and password will be generated by the
system and displayed on the screen. Candidate should note down the Provisional
registration number and password. An Email & SMS indicating the Provisional
Registration number and Password will also be sent. Candidates can reopen the
saved data using Provisional registration number and password and edit the
particulars, if needed.
 Candidates are required to upload their photograph and signature as per the
specifications given in the Guidelines for Scanning and Upload of Photograph and
Signature.
 Candidates while filling their on-line application, the name of the candidate and his
/ her father / husband etc. should be spelt correctly in the application as it appears
in the certificates / mark sheets. Any change / alteration found may disqualify the
candidature.
 The candidates name in the online application should be as it appears in SSC/SSLC/X
Standard Marks Card. In case the candidate has changed his/her name, the changed
name should be as per the Gazette Notification/ Marriage Certificate.
 Candidates should fill all the fields in the on-line application.
 Candidates are advised to carefully fill in the online application themselves as no
change in any of the data filled in the online application will be possible/
entertained. Prior to submission of the online application candidates are advised to
use the “SAVE AND NEXT” facility to verify the details in the online application form
and modify the same if required. No change is permitted after clicking on FINAL
SUBMIT Button. Submission of incorrect / false information in the online application
will render the candidature invalid.
 After completion of on-line registration, candidate should take system generated
print-out of Registered On-line Application.
 An email/ SMS intimation with the Registration Number and Password generated
on successful registration of the application will be sent to the candidate’s email ID/
Mobile Number specified in the online application form as a system generated
acknowledgement. If candidate do not receive the email and SMS intimation at the
email ID/ Mobile number specified by them, they may consider that their online
application has not been successfully registered.
 An online application which is incomplete in any respect such as without proper
passport size photograph and signature uploaded in the online application form/
unsuccessful fee payment will not be considered as valid and will be rejected. No
further communication will be made in this regard.
 Retain a copy of the final on-line application print out along with Registration
Number & Password safely for your records.
 A candidate should submit only one application. In case of multiple applications only
the latest valid completed application will be retained.
 Any information submitted by an applicant in his/ her application shall be binding
on the candidate personally and he/she shall be liable for prosecution/ civil
consequences in case the information/ details furnished by him/ her are found to
be false at a later stage.
 Bank will not be responsible for any consequences arising out of furnishing of
incorrect and incomplete details in the application or omission to provide the
required details in the application form.

Guidelines for scanning and Upload of Documents


Before applying online, a candidate will be required to have a scanned (digital)
image of his/her photograph, signature, left thumb impression, hand written
declaration, as per the specifications given below.
Photograph Image: (4.5cm × 3.5cm)
 Photograph must be a recent passport style colour picture.
 Make sure that the picture is in colour, taken against a light-coloured, preferably
white background.
 Look straight at the camera with a relaxed face
 If the picture is taken on a sunny day, have the sun behind you, or place yourself in
the shade, so that you are not squinting and there are no harsh shadows
 If you have to use flash, ensure there's no "red-eye"
 If you wear glasses make sure that there are no reflections and your eyes can be
clearly seen.
 Caps, hats and dark glasses are not acceptable. Religious headwear is allowed but
it must not cover your face.
 Dimensions 200 x 230 pixels (preferred)
 Size of file should be between 20kb–50 kb
 Ensure that the size of the scanned image is not more than 50kb. If the size of the
file is more than 50 kb, then adjust the settings of the scanner such as the DPI
resolution, no. of colours etc., during the process of scanning.
 Photo uploaded should be of appropriate size and clearly visible.
Signature, left thumb impression and hand-written declaration Image:
 The applicant has to sign on white paper with Black Ink pen.
a) Dimensions 140 x 60 pixels (preferred)
b) Size of file should be between 10kb – 20kb
c) Ensure that the size of the scanned image is not more than 20kb
d) Signature uploaded should be of appropriate size and clearly visible.
 The applicant has to put his left thumb impression on a white paper with black or
blue ink.
a) File type: jpg / jpeg
b) Dimensions: 240 x 240 pixels in 200 DPI (Preferred for required quality) i.e
3cm * 3 cm (Width * Height)
c) File Size: 20 KB – 50 KB
 The applicant has to write the declaration in English clearly on a white paper
with black ink.
a) File type: jpg / jpeg
b) Dimensions: 800 x 400 pixels in 200 DPI (Preferred for required quality) i.e
10 cm * 5 cm (Width * Height)
c) File Size: 50 KB – 100 KB
 The signature, left thumb impression and the hand written declaration should be
of the applicant and not by any other person.
 Signature / Hand written declaration in CAPITAL LETTERS shall NOT be accepted.
 Ensure that the photo, signature, left thumb impression and hand written
declaration, are uploaded at the specified spaces only in the online application
form.
Scanning the documents:
a) Set the scanner resolution to a minimum of 200 dpi (dots per inch)
b) Set Colour to True Colour
c) File Size as specified above
d) Crop the image in the scanner to the edge of the photograph/signature/ left thumb
impression / hand written declaration, then use the upload editor to crop the image
to the final size (as specified above).
e) The image file should be JPG or JPEG format. An example file name is: image01.jpg
or image01.jpeg. Image dimensions can be checked by listing the folder files or
moving the mouse over the file image icon.
f) Candidates using MS Windows/MS Office can easily obtain documents in .jpeg
format by using MS Paint or MS Office Picture Manager. Scanned documents in any
format can be saved in .jpg / .jpeg format by using ‘Save As’ option in the File menu.
Size can be adjusted by using crop and then resize option.
Procedure for uploading the documents
a) While filling in the Online Application Form the candidate will be provided with
separate links for uploading Photograph, signature, left thumb impression and hand
written declaration
b) Click on the respective link “Upload Photograph / signature / Upload left thumb
impression / hand written declaration,”
c) Browse and Select the location where the Scanned Photograph / signature / left
thumb impression / hand written declaration, file has been saved.
d) Select the file by clicking on it
e) Click the ‘Open/Upload’
f) If the file size and format are not as prescribed, an error message will be
displayed.
g) Preview of the uploaded image will help to see the quality of the image. In case of
unclear / smudged, the same may be re-uploaded to the expected clarity /quality.
Your Online Application will not be registered unless you upload your Photograph,
signature, left thumb impression and hand written declaration, as specified.
Note:
a) In case the face in the photograph or signature or left thumb impression or the hand
written declaration, is unclear / smudged the candidate’s application may be
rejected.
b) After uploading the Photograph / signature / left thumb impression / hand written
declaration, in the online application form candidates should check that the images
are clear and have been uploaded correctly. In case the photograph or signature or
left thumb impression or the hand written declaration– if applicable, is not
prominently visible, the candidate may edit his/ her application and re-upload his/
her photograph or signature or left thumb impression or the hand written
declaration– if applicable, prior to submitting the form.
c) Candidate should also ensure that photo is uploaded at the place of photo and
signature at the place of signature. If photo in place of photo and signature in place
of signature is not uploaded properly, candidate will not be shortlisted for further
process.
d) Candidate must ensure that Photo to be uploaded is of required size and the face
should be clearly visible.
e) Candidates should ensure that the signature uploaded is clearly visible

Mode of Payment:

Candidates have the option of making the payment of requisite fees/ intimation
charges through the ONLINE mode only:
a) Candidates should carefully fill in the details in the Online Application form at the
appropriate places very carefully and click on the “COMPLETE REGISTRATION”
button at the end of the Online Application format. Before pressing the
“COMPLETE REGISTRATION” button, candidates are advised to verify every field
filled in the application form. The name of the candidate or his /her
father/husband etc. should be spelt correctly in the application form as it appears
in the certificates/mark sheets. Any change/alteration found may disqualify the
candidature.
In case the candidate is unable to fill in the application form in one go, he/ she can
save the data already entered. When the data is saved, a provisional registration
number and password will be generated by the system and displayed on the
screen. Candidate should note down the Provisional registration number and
password. An Email & SMS indicating the Provisional Registration number and
Password will also be sent. They can reopen the saved data using Provisional
registration number and password and edit the particulars, if needed. Once the
application form is filled in completely, candidate should submit the data.
b) The online application form is integrated with the payment gateway and the
payment process can be completed by following the instructions.
c) The payment can be made by using Debit Cards (RuPay/ Visa/ MasterCard/
Maestro), Credit Cards, Internet Banking, IMPS, Cash Cards/ Mobile Wallets by
providing information as asked on the screen.
d) After Final Submit, an additional page of the online application form is displayed
wherein candidates may follow the instructions and fill in the requisite details.
e) If the online transaction has not been successfully completed, then candidates are
advised to login again with their provisional registration number and password
and pay the Application Fees/ Intimation Charges online.
f) On successful completion of the transaction, an e-receipt will be generated.
g) Candidates are required to take a printout of the e-receipt and online application
form. Please note that if the same cannot be generated then online transaction
may not have been successful.
Note:
 After submitting your payment information in the online application form,
please wait for the intimation from the server, DO NOT press Back or Refresh
button in order to avoid double charge
 For Credit Card users: All charges are listed in Indian Rupee. If you use a non-
Indian credit card, your bank will convert to your local currency based on
prevailing exchange rates.
 To ensure the security of your data, please close the browser window once
your transaction is completed.
After completing the procedure of applying online including payment of fees /
intimation charges, the candidate should take a printout of the system generated
online application form, ensure the particulars filled in are accurate and retain it along
with Registration Number and Password for future reference. They should not send
this printout to the IBPS/ Bank.
Please note that all the particulars mentioned in the online application including
Name of the Candidate, Category, Date of Birth, Address, Mobile Number, Email ID,
State, Districts in which applied for etc. will be considered as final and no
change/modifications will be allowed after submission of the online application
form. Candidates are hence advised to fill in the online application form with the
utmost care as no correspondence regarding change of details will be entertained.
Bank will not be responsible for any consequences arising out of furnishing of
incorrect and incomplete details in the online application form or omission to
provide the required details in the online application form.
An email/ SMS intimation with the Registration Number and Password generated on
successful registration of the application will be sent to the candidate’s email ID/
Mobile Number specified in the online application form as a system generated
acknowledgement. If candidates do not receive the email and SMS intimations at the
email ID/ Mobile number specified by them, they may consider that their online
application has not been successfully registered.
An online application which is incomplete in any respect such as without proper
passport size photograph, signature, left thumb impression and the hand written
declaration, uploaded in the online application form/ unsuccessful fee/intimation
charges payment will not be considered as valid.
Candidates are advised to apply on-line much before the closing date and not to wait
till the last date for depositing the fee / intimation charges to avoid the possibility
of disconnection/ inability/ failure to log on to the authorized Banks website
www.ibps.in on account of heavy load on internet/website jam.
Please note that the above procedure is the only valid procedure for applying. No
other mode of application or incomplete steps would be accepted and such
applications would be rejected.
